The board of directors of Gaekwar Mills approved the unaudited financial results for the quarter ended June 30, 2026, on August 14, 2026. The textile manufacturer reported a widening net loss of ₹241.07 lakh for the period, compared to a loss of ₹112.14 lakh in the same quarter of the previous fiscal year.

The company recorded zero income from operations for both the current and prior year quarters. Consequently, the net loss before tax remained identical to the net loss after tax at ₹241.07 lakh, indicating no tax benefit or expense was recognized against the losses. Earnings per share stood at negative ₹12.05 for the quarter, down from negative ₹48.37 in the full previous fiscal year.

Financial Position

The balance sheet metrics disclosed in the filing show static capital structures with no accumulation of reserves.

Metric: Q1FY27 Q1FY26 Change
Total Income from Operations: ₹0 lakh ₹0 lakh
Net Profit / (Loss) After Tax: (₹241.07 lakh) (₹112.14 lakh) Widened
Equity Share Capital: ₹200 lakh ₹200 lakh No Change
Reserves: ₹0 lakh ₹0 lakh No Change

Equity share capital remained constant at ₹200 lakh. Reserves, excluding revaluation reserves, were reported at nil for both the current quarter and the comparative periods.

Regulatory Disclosure

Gaekwar Mills filed its results under Regulation 30 and Regulation 47(3) of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The company cited the conclusion of the board meeting on a Friday evening and the unavailability of publishers during the national holiday on August 15, 2026, as reasons for the delayed publication of the financial results in newspapers.

Gaekwar Mills reported a net loss of ₹945 lakh for the financial year ended March 31, 2026, compared to a net loss of ₹442 lakh in the previous year. The company recorded zero revenue from operations for the year, while other income stood at ₹58 lakh. The Board of Directors approved the audited financial results for the fourth quarter and financial year ended March 31, 2026, at a meeting held on May 28, 2026.

The loss for the quarter ended March 31, 2026, widened to ₹968 lakh from ₹112 lakh in the corresponding period of the previous year. Total expenses for the quarter surged to ₹993 lakh, primarily driven by a premium on debenture redemption written off amounting to ₹988 lakh. The board also approved the re-appointment of M/s. VKMG & Associates, LLP Company Secretaries as Secretarial Auditors for the financial year 2026-2027.

Financial Performance

The company's financial statements for FY26 reflect significant one-time costs. The premium on debenture redemption written off for the full year was ₹988 lakh. Consequently, the loss per share for FY26 was reported at ₹47.26, compared to ₹22.12 in the previous year.

Metric FY26 (₹ in lakhs) FY25 (₹ in lakhs)
Total Revenue 58 41
Total Expenses 1,004 484
Net Profit/(Loss) (945) (442)
Earnings Per Share (47.26) (22.12)

Debt and Asset Position

The company has extended the redemption date for its Secured Non-Convertible Debentures. The Series A debentures of ₹30 crore, along with a redemption premium of ₹37.20 crore, have been extended to March 31, 2028, with an additional premium of ₹26.88 crore. The Series B debentures of ₹5 crore, with a redemption premium of ₹2.00 crore, have also been extended to March 31, 2028, incurring an additional premium of ₹2.80 crore.

As of March 31, 2026, the company's total assets stood at ₹2,552 lakh, a significant increase from ₹522 lakh in the previous year, largely due to an increase in other non-current assets. Total equity was negative at ₹(8,406) lakh, widening from the previous year's negative equity of ₹(7,460) lakh. M/s. M D Pandya & Associates, Chartered Accountants, issued an unmodified opinion on the standalone audited financial results.
